Both artificial insemination and ova transfer require the insertion of foreign bodies or instruments into the uterus. When such instruments enter this organ, there is always the possibility of introducing various kinds of bacteria. Very little information is available regarding the pathogenicity of these bacteria in the bovine uterus. The possibility of abortion due to such pathogenic organisms as those causing brucellosis and trichomoniasis has been known for some time. Whether or not other contamination organisms placed in the uterus by seemingly sterile instruments will reduce fertility, increase abortions, or cause permanent sterility has not been established.
